Core responsibilities

The role involves planning, coordinating, developing, and implementing professional individual and group counseling programs for assigned students, ensuring compliance with directives. Essential functions include reviewing student files, conducting interviews, maintaining records, and providing direct aid for personal needs or problems.

Requirements summary

Candidates must possess a bachelor's degree which includes 15 semester hours in social services related instruction, along with one year of experience in counseling or a related field. Required qualifications also include experience with youth, excellent written and verbal communication skills, computer proficiency, and a valid driver's license with an acceptable driving record.
